Introducing Condition Tracker version 1.0.0, a Roll20 API script for managing token conditions and custom effects within the Turn Tracker.
Find dicussions on this new mod on the Roll20 forums: https://app.roll20.net/forum/post/12736090/script-condition-tracker
The script offers:
- Guided GM workflows, including an interactive wizard and a multi-target application, accessible via chat commands and auto-installed macros.
- Rich effect modelling for standard D&D conditions and custom types like Spell, Ability, Advantage, Disadvantage, and Other, with duplicate prevention and per-target tracking.
- Deep Turn Tracker integration with stable custom rows, source-based grouping for advantage/disadvantage, and various duration types (until removed, end-of-turn, numeric rounds).
- Comprehensive lifecycle management, featuring expiry-based removal, zero-HP cleanup prompts, proactive token-deletion pruning, and manual reconciliation for orphaned entries.
- A configurable marker system for applying and safely removing status markers from tokens.
- Internationalisation support for chat messages, wizard prompts, and help content across 24 locales.
- A robust, modular architecture designed for performance and extensibility.
Introduction Video
You can view the introduction video on YouTube: https://youtu.be/gllliINRQsQ
Where to install the mod from?
- Roll20 One-Click Installer.
- Roll20 API GitHub master branch.
- Download and install manually from Dropbox.